每年都有很多人选择报考计算机专业,那么,计算机专业主要学哪些课程呢?要掌握什么技能呢?下面小编整理了一些相关信息,供大家参考!
计算机专业要学什么
学习计算机,需要有一定的数学及英语基础,在硬件方面最好也有一些电路电子基础。另外,掌握几门开发语言是必须的,一般会从c语言开始学起,然后学一门面向对象的语言,一般是c++或是java。
算法与数据结构等也是必须要学的,数据结构的链表,队列,图等都是重要内容,还有算法中的排序,查找,搜索等。数据库也是必须要学的,sql语句,数据库范式等等。
计算机组成原理以及计算机系统结构等关于计算机硬件组成的课程,还有计算机操作系统等都是必须要学习的内容,同样计算机网络也不能少。
计算机专业开设哪些课程
计算机专业是硬件和软件相结合,面向系统,侧重应用的一个宽口径专业。主要培养的人才就是具有扎实的基础知识,具有开拓创新意识,在计算机科学与技术领域从事科学研究,教育,开发和应用的高级人才。
计算机专业的主干学科有数据结构,计算机网络,操作系统,计算机原理等,所以,主要专业课程包含电路原理,模拟电子技术,数字逻辑,数值分析,计算机原理,微型计算机技术,计算机系统结构,计算机网络,高级语言,数据库原理,离散数学,概率统计,线性代数以及算法设计与分析。
此外,就是实践课程,包括电子工艺实习,硬件部件设计及调试,计算机基础训练,课程设计,计算机工程实践,毕业设计等实践性教学环节。
计算机学科的特色主要体现在理论性强,实践性强,发展迅速等方面。比较注重数学,逻辑,数据结构,算法,电子设计,计算机体系结构和系统软件等方面的理论基础和专业基础。一般学生在大学前两年会更注重学习基础课程,而后两年则是更注重专业课程。